Looking for a wicked fun way to spend a night on Halloween weekend? Join us for the first ever Market Haunt: an electrifying, music-filled new Halloween experience coming to downtown Guelph.

On October 26th from 7:00PM-12:00AM, The Guelph Farmers’ Market will be transformed into a lively, spooky, spirited Halloween party. With local music, dancing, costumes, incredible food and drinks – Market Haunt will have everything you need to make this a chilling night to remember.
The Guelph Farmers’ Market is a physically accessible space located at 2 Gordon Street in the heart of downtown Guelph. This unique historical space has lots of room for dancing and socializing, with plenty of seating options as well.

ABOUT THE GUELPH FARMERS’ MARKET
The Guelph Farmers’ Market has been a community cornerstone in Guelph since 1827.
Having operated for almost 200 years, it is an important community asset and civic space.
The current location, formerly a horse barn on Wilson Street, has been the Market’s home for over 50 years. In 2022, 10C Shared Space assumed the operations and activation of the Farmers’ Market building, grounds and events.
ABOUT 10C
10C Shared Space – Located at 42 Carden Street, is a hub for community changemakers in Guelph-Wellington. 10C uses placemaking, social enterprise, social finance, social innovation – and food – to create new ways to connect, collaborate and share resources.
